- again, know your settings: this method works well for fluid
collections which e.g. use undenatured alcohol or were the denaturing
agent is not reactive against plastics. I would definitely refrain to
use this labelling method in our fish collection as we have to use MEK
denatured alcohol. MEK is a highly aggressive and reactive ketone, which
is very well known to cracks down polymer-chains.
European collections should be very careful here, especially in the
light of the new EU-directive EU No. 162/2013 which prescribes even
higher amounts of MEK for denaturing and prescribes usage of MEK in
those countries which used different denaturing agents prior to 2013
(e.g. IMS / camphor).

> Wet collections have been using this system for some time now for alcohol labels with very good results. We are printing on to a spun bound polyester using a thermal transfer printer and wax/resin ribbon. This is obviously not a sticky backed label kind of media but I am sure a similar kind of thing could be sourced. >> We are looking for a print-on-demand (printing one label at a time)
>> method of annotating herbarium sheets. Can anyone share their
>> experience with thermal transfer label printers (_not_ direct thermal)
>> using wax resin ribbons and polypropylene labels? I am particularly
>> interested in the community's opinion on the likelihood that such
>> labels will be readable for the long term and will not break down.
>>
>> We are considering the purchase of a Zebra GC420t printer, wax/resin
>> ribbons and polypropylene labels.
